For the price, you can't beat it

So I'll get the cons out of the way first, since they are minor. First, the kit isn't really packaged in a reusable way, unless you plan on using the paper, cardboard, and bubble wrap that's in there. I plan on using some left over inserts from my other cases to make this better. Putting the softboxes together and affixing them to the light fixture is a weird process and kind of clunky at first. The softboxes have vents in the back that let light out, but they aren't going to be an issue in most lighting situations. They are halogen lights so expect lots of heat, and buy gloves. Now for the PROS: The light quality is fantastic! The build quality is sturdy, and the stands are robust (hard to get in a light kit this cheap). I have no worries about these things holding up. Bulbs are cheap and interchangeable with different wattages/intensities ~$10 per After investing a lot in gear and not wanting to spend any more, I decided that softboxes were necessary but looked for the cheapest possible option. Couldn't find anything decent or halfway bright for my price range on B&H, then I found these. Really, if you're okay with the heat of halogen lights and don't need the bells and whistles of LEDs (dimmers, etc.) then these will produce great quality light and last a long time. Can't go wrong at this price range -- very happy customer.

• The Everlight Kit is a completely self-contained photo studio for TV interviews, Commercial videography, digital portraits and family reunion shots.
• The kit is composed of the three ultra-silent lights with 500 watt (3200k) self-focused quartz bulbs. Optional bulbs in 250 watt, 500 watt, 1000 watt and 1200 watt are also available. Heat-resistant soft boxes, compact air-cushioned stands and a foam-padded carrying/ storage case complete this kit.
• The kit sets up in minutes! Just add a digital camera or camcorder and you are ready to make professional looking photos and video tapes.

• The complete Everlight Kit measures only 28"x 8"x 14" when stored in its case.

Key Features

  • Variable light output by changing bulbs
  • 3200k tungston balanced bulbs
  • Entire kit sets up in minutes
  • Weighs under five pounds
